Market Overview

With 401 auto mechanics operating in Irving, the market is intensely competitive. This high density means a shop is competing for every customer against hundreds of others. A critical factor for standing out is digital presence, yet only 65% of these businesses have a website. That leaves 35%—over 140 shops—relying solely on foot traffic, referrals, or directory listings, creating a significant opportunity gap for those who invest in a professional online footprint. The presence of national chains like Firestone Complete Auto Care alongside specialized rebuilders like Coyote Engines Rebuilders and niche services like Foggy Window Pro shows a market with both broad and deep competition. For any new or existing shop, the challenge isn't just fixing cars; it's cutting through the noise of over 400 competitors to be found and chosen by local drivers.
